~20km Long VMMZ Structure
The VMMZ mineralized assemblage is hosted in intercalated lenses of graphitic black shales, carbonates and calc-silicate altered lenses of ultramafic flows which contain elevated zinc, copper, and nickel sulfides. The shales are comprised of deep marine sedimentary layers, interpreted to be some distance from the sub-sea volcanic source of the mineralization, and range in thickness from .5 to several meters containing pyrite, pyrrhotite, sphalerite, and chalcopyrite mineralization (Zn/Cu/Ag). The intercalated ultramafic flows and lenses range in thickness from several meters to tens of meters in thickness and host Ni (and companion elements) mineralization throughout, generally grading in a range between 0.15-0.3%. Renforth has observed a stacking of mineralized zones, which creates multiple contact zones between the VMS shales and the ultramafic, a positive development proven in the recent drilling. States Francis Newton P.Geo OGQ: "Regional amphibolite grade metamorphism has affected the ultramafic flows to tremolite and locally carbonate, diopside and feldspar. The heat from this interaction, along with subsequent hydrothermal alteration, has mobilized the contained nickel mineralization present at the contact between volcanic flows of ultramafic composition and the graphitic mudstone. This process resulted in sulfide nickel enrichment within the contact zone calc silicate lithology. This mineralized horizon is continuous in varying widths along the length of the magnetic anomaly and, as we have seen in the 2.5km section, is actually repeated at least three times creating a series of stacked mineralized calc silicates separated by lenses of ultramafic bodies."

VMMZ Mineralization
The mineralization within the VMMZ is described by
Mineralization is strongest along the contact with the graphitic mudstone in a calc-silicate alteration zone widely identified in core logging where metamorphic alteration concentrated the mineralization in pyrrhotite, pentlandite and occasional millerite sulfides. There is little to no olivine nor magnesium within the alteration zone and the bulk of the nickel is sulfide hosted." Renforth intends to continue this petrographic identification work, including with recent drill core. Additionally, the company aims to initiate thorough testing for platinum and palladium. Previous testing, albeit limited to only a handful of samples, has confirmed the presence of Pt and Pd within the system.

2023 Drill Program Assay Highlights
The 2023 drill program holes, planned on the basis of distance in order to fill gaps in the drill pattern, bring the spacing to ~100m between drillholes across the ~2.5km. This program succeeded in intersecting the mineralized system in each hole, confirming the presence of at least 3 repetitions of mineralized zone, possibly due to multiple intrusive events.
Footnotes to the Assay Tables
1 - Intervals stated are as measured in the core box, not true widths. At this time, true widths are not known.
2 - TheMetal Eq% formula used = (Metal value+(additional metal ppm value*(additional metal $/gram)/(metal $/gram)))/10000
3 - Metal values used in the Eq formulas are as follows (Spot price dates for each metal with the USD price per gram)
4 - The Ni Eq % and Zn Eq % are calculated without a cutoff. Renforth has only performed limited thin section work and no metallurgical work, the percent recovery of metals during processing is not known and is therefore not assumed.
5 -The assay methods used in the early stages of exploration was Na-peroxide fusion. The assay method was changed to Aqua Regia which is still in use. Renforth is working on standardizing the analytical method used going forward to provide more reliable geochemistry compatible with future calculations and modelling work.
